Multi Image Downloader(Freeware)

   [Download all images from a webpage with one click] Multi Image Downloader takes advantage of the magnificent Google Images search engine to seek out and download images without having to work through multiple sites to get at the original images. This program will parse Google Images pages for original source image references and download, in a very short time, up to 5 pages or 100 images. The actual time will depend on a number of factors but 100 images should take about 15 seconds. Once downloaded, you can then easily scan through the images with a graphics program.
